IVdsVolume2::GetProperties2-Methode (vds.h)
[Ab Windows 8 und Windows Server 2012 wird die COM-Schnittstelle des Virtuellen Datenträgerdiensts durch die Windows Storage Management-API abgelöst.]
Gibt Eigenschafteninformationen für das aktuelle Volume zurück. Diese Methode ist identisch mit der IVdsVolume::GetProperties-Methode, mit der Ausnahme, dass sie anstelle einer VDS_VOLUME_PROP-Struktur eine VDS_VOLUME_PROP2-Struktur zurückgibt.
Syntax
HRESULT GetProperties2(
[out] VDS_VOLUME_PROP2 *pVolumeProperties
);
Parameter
[out] pVolumeProperties
Die Adresse der VDS_VOLUME_PROP2 Struktur zugeordnet und vom Aufrufer übergeben. VDS weist Arbeitsspeicher für die pwszName-Memberzeichenfolge zu. Aufrufer müssen die Zeichenfolge mithilfe der Funktion CoTaskMemFree freigeben.
Rückgabewert
Diese Methode kann HRESULT-Standardwerte wie E_INVALIDARG oder E_OUTOFMEMORY und VDS-spezifische Rückgabewerte zurückgeben. Es kann auch konvertierte Systemfehlercodes mithilfe des makros HRESULT_FROM_WIN32 zurückgeben. Fehler können vom VDS selbst oder vom zugrunde liegenden VDS-Anbieter stammen, der verwendet wird. Folgende Rückgabewerte sind möglich.
Rückgabecode/-wert | BESCHREIBUNG |
---|---|
|
Die Methode wurde erfolgreich abgeschlossen. |
|
Einige, aber nicht alle Eigenschaften wurden erfolgreich abgerufen. Beachten Sie, dass es viele mögliche Gründe dafür gibt, dass nicht alle Eigenschaften abgerufen werden, einschließlich der Geräteentfernung. |
Hinweise
Diese Methode ruft den eindeutigen Volumebezeichner für ein Volume ab. Die Struktur, die diesen Bezeichner enthält, ist VDS_VOLUME_PROP2, nicht VDS_VOLUME_PROP.
Beachten Sie, dass ein eindeutiger Volumebezeichner nicht mit einem Volume-GUID-Pfad identisch ist. Um die Volume-GUID-Pfade für ein Volume zu finden, verwenden Sie die IVdsVolumeMF3::QueryVolumeGuidPathnames-Methode .
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) | Windows 7 [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) | Windows Server 2008 R2 [nur Desktop-Apps] |
Zielplattform | Windows |
Kopfzeile | vds.h |
Bibliothek | Uuid.lib |